Lighthouse
is a lighthouse in , southern . It was built in 1864 and is 29 metres high. It is automatic and electric, its light controlled by photoelectric cells. is situated 400 metres west of Edificio Manila.

Church
is a church in , . Built in the 15th century after the capture of Marbella by the Crown of Castile, it is the oldest religious building in the city. is situated 320 metres north of Edificio Manila.
